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C) and have an 8”x 8” (20 cm x 20 cm) glass baking dish ready.

In a medium bowl, mix the flour, coconut, cinnamon, allspice, cloves, dates and vanilla together.

Halve the apples and cut away the stems. Trim a little off of each “bottom” to create a level surface so that the apples don’t roll around in the dish. Use a spoon to scoop out the cores, and then arrange the apples in the baking dish.

Add the oil to the streusel mix and use a pastry cutter to cut the mix into coarse crumbs. Fill the apple halves with the streusel and pour the cider into the bottom of the baking dish.

Tightly cover the baking dish with foil or a heat-safe lid. Bake for 20 minutes, and then uncover and continue to bake for another 15 minutes, or until the apples have reached the desired tenderness. Serve the apples warm with a dollop of mascarpone.

Leftover apples can be refrigerated for 5 days.
